The MIC29151-5.0WU is a high-performance, low-dropout (LDO) voltage regulator from Microchip Technology, designed to provide a fixed output voltage of 5.0V with an impressive accuracy. This regulator is capable of delivering up to 1.5A of output current, making it suitable for a wide range of applications, from powering sensitive analog circuits to serving as a reliable power source for digital systems.
Key Features:
- Output Voltage: Fixed 5.0V with high accuracy.
- Output Current: Capable of delivering up to 1.5A.
- Low Dropout: Offers a low dropout voltage, which enhances efficiency and allows operation closer to the input voltage.
- Thermal and Overcurrent Protection: Features built-in protection mechanisms that safeguard the device and the load from adverse conditions.
- Wide Operating Temperature Range: Suitable for industrial applications with an operating temperature range from -40°C to +125°C.
The MIC29151-5.0WU is designed with a robust package, ensuring reliable performance even in harsh environments. Its TO-263 (D2PAK) package is designed for optimal heat dissipation, which is critical for maintaining stability and performance when delivering higher currents.
